BMW’s Spider-Man ad: Luxury meets marketing?

SUNI thinks BMW might be pushing its customers too far, even for a superhero.

BMW's decision to beam an advert for Spider-Man into drivers' infotainment systems could be seen as a step too far. The carmaker argues it’s merely a 'festive animation', but the reality is that customers are seeing product placement in their luxury vehicles, which feels like a downgrade from paying over £70k for a car.


The ad plays as a 19-second video, triggered by clicking on a message suggesting a surprise gift. While not automatically played, it remains visible and intrusive. Social media reactions range from annoyance to outright bewilderment at the intrusion of ads in premium vehicles.


BMW is far from the first brand to use car screens for advertising; dashboard displays have long been transitioned from analogue dials to digital interfaces. However, BMW's approach seems more aggressive than its peers, and customers are feeling betrayed by what was marketed as a high-tech feature. This move could damage the perceived quality of the brand.


The incident reflects broader questions about how far technology should go in blurring lines between private space and commercial engagement. While it may be a test to gauge customer acceptance, BMW risks alienating its core audience with such an invasive tactic.
